Sentences with SCROUNGED (5)
The next day, with the aid of a few "scrounged" top poles and some string, every man made himself some sort of weather-proof hutch, while the combined tent-valises of the officers were grouped together near the farm, which was used as mess and Quartermaster's Stores.
She had scrounged up a naval engineer, or what she called a naval engineer--he had once been a stoker on a ferryboat.
Nothing that fifteen to twenty grand wouldn't have fixed--but while I scrounged around, trying to get cash, I kited a few checks.
Now maybe you can't change history, but what's there to prevent a soldier from changing his mind about the gal he is going to marry?_ * * * * * Clark Decker winced and scrounged still lower in his seat as Mrs.
However, we sheltered in odd holes and corners, scrounged about for what we could "souvenir" and made ourselves as snug as possible.
